With hops from both northern (El Dorado, Mosaic, Azacca, Citra) and southern (Moutere, Galaxy, Nelson Sauvin) hemispheres, this heroic IPA hits all the right notes – pine and herbal aromas from the north, balanced by down under varietals delivering passionfruit, mango, and citrus. They all come together beautifully in this extravagant dual hemisphere IPA, highlighting some of the best Humulus Lupulus flowers on the planet.

12oz can into a 16oz nonic pint glass.
L: Pours a cloudy vibrant yellow gold with a thin, white fizzy head that quickly recedes to a thin skin and edge foam. Medium-high carbonation and a few tiny dark sediment chunks. Minimal skeletal lacing.
S: Huge pineapple smell right from the can opening. Then poured is pineapple, orange, mango and light pine. Quite tropical.
T: Pineapple, orange, mango, passion fruit and light grains. It is not complex.
F: I found this beer to be moderately light-bodied and alive. It is crisp & snappy with somewhat of a non-offending orange soda pop/orange cola mouthfeel that is a little bit prickly and is semi-dry. It has a comfortably fast finish.
O: With it's curious feel Space Camper IPA is very easy drinking for it's 5.9%ABV and is redolent of a session IPA in many respects. It is simple and very good in it's style.
